How to Reduce Noise from an Air Mattress

The first step to reducing noise from an air mattress is to identify the source of the noise. Is it the material rubbing against each other? Is it the air pump? Or is it the bed frame? Once you've pinpointed the source, you can take the necessary steps to fix it.

Quiet Air Mattress Solutions

If your air mattress is noisy due to the material rubbing against each other, there are a few solutions you can try. Firstly, make sure the mattress is properly inflated. An improperly inflated mattress can cause the materials to rub against each other and create noise. You can also try using a mattress topper or a sheet of fabric to act as a barrier between the materials and reduce friction.

How to Silence a Loud Air Mattress

If the noise is coming from the air pump, there are a few things you can do to silence it. First, make sure the pump is securely attached to the mattress and there are no loose parts. You can also try placing a towel or cloth underneath the pump to absorb any vibrations. If the noise persists, consider investing in a quieter air pump or placing the pump on a soft surface, such as a rug or carpet.

Ways to Reduce Air Mattress Noise

If the noise is coming from the bed frame, there are a few ways to reduce it. Firstly, make sure the bed frame is sturdy and properly assembled. A loose or wobbly bed frame can cause noise as you move on the mattress. You can also try placing a foam pad or rubber mat underneath the bed frame to absorb any vibrations.

The Culprit: Vinyl Material

air mattress makes too much noise The primary reason for the excessive noise from air mattresses is the material they are made of – vinyl. While it's durable and inexpensive, it's also known for being loud and squeaky. Every time you shift or move, the vinyl rubs against itself, creating that unmistakable sound that can keep you up all night.

What Can Be Done?

air mattress makes too much noise So what can be done to combat the noise from an air mattress? One solution is to invest in a higher quality air mattress that is made with a thicker, more durable material. The thicker vinyl will be less likely to make noise when you move, and you may find yourself sleeping more soundly as a result. Another option is to place a soft, thick blanket or mattress pad on top of the air mattress. This can help to cushion the noise and make it less noticeable. You can also try placing the air mattress on a carpeted surface instead of a hard floor, as this can also help to absorb some of the noise.
